Multiple People Shot at Howe Community Park in Sacramento County
Four people were hospitalized in stable condition after deputies dispersed an unauthorized gathering and heard 20 to 25 gunshots, officials said.
- On Saturday night, four people were injured in a shooting at Howe Community Park in Sacramento after the Sacramento County Sheriff's Office responded to an unauthorized gathering.
- Deputies arrived around 6:30 p.m. following reports of individuals carrying concealed weapons at Howe Park. Authorities spent 15 minutes broadcasting announcements over loudspeakers urging the hundreds gathered to leave.
- During the dispersal, deputies heard 20 to 25 gunshots, sending crowds running from the park. Sgt. Edward Igoe, a sheriff's office spokesperson, said, "These individuals had the audacity to start firing."
- All four victims were transported to local hospitals with minor to moderate injuries and remain in stable condition. The sheriff's office stated there is no known ongoing threat to the public.
- Investigators found shell casings along Cottage Way near a Home Depot but have not recovered any weapons. Anyone with information is encouraged to contact the sheriff's non-emergency line at 874-5115.
